Do you have to have a special hard drive to record onto a CD?

No, you don't need a special hard drive to record onto a CD. Any standard hard drive can store the files you want to burn to a CD. However, you do need a CD burner or optical drive that supports writing to CDs, along with compatible software to facilitate the burning process.

Can a CD or CD RW drive read a DVD?

Typically a drive marked as being a 'CD' or a 'CD RW' drive, will not be able to read a DVD. You will need one marked as being at least a 'DVD' drive, which will be able to read DVDs and CDs too.
